what these connections feel like
Some relationships seem to go beyond logic or everyday experience. As described, “some human connections seem to go beyond logic or everyday experience,” creating bonds that feel deep and meaningful even without constant contact.
sense of familiarity
These connections often feel instantly recognizable, as if people are reconnecting rather than meeting for the first time. Even with distance or silence, “the connection feels steady and present,” giving a lasting sense of closeness.
shared experiences and synchronicity
A key sign is synchronicity—moments that feel too aligned to be coincidence. Thinking about someone at the same time or reconnecting unexpectedly can strengthen the feeling of an unseen bond.
emotional and intuitive understanding
These relationships often involve strong emotional awareness. People may understand each other without words, showing empathy and connection that grows over time. Intuition also plays a role, as some bonds feel important immediately without clear reasons.
lasting meaning
Whether explained by psychology or something more intuitive, these connections leave a real impact. They shape personal growth, deepen understanding, and create a sense of closeness that can remain strong across time and distance.
